XML DOM removeAttributeNS() Method


Element Object Reference Complete Element Object Reference

Definition and Usage

The removeAttributeNS() method removes an attribute specified by namespace and name.

Syntax

elementNode.removeAttributeNS(ns,name)

Parameter Description
ns Required. Specifies the namespace of the attribute to remove
name Required. Specifies the name attribute to remove


Example

The following code fragment loads "books_ns.xml" into xmlDoc using loadXMLDoc() and removes the "lang" attribute from the first <title> element:

Example

xmlDoc=loadXMLDoc("books_ns.xml");

x=xmlDoc.getElementsByTagName("title")[0];
ns="http://www.w3schools.com/children/";

document.write("Attribute Found: ");
document.write(x.hasAttributeNS(ns,"lang"));

x.removeAttributeNS(ns,"lang");

document.write("<br />Attribute Found: ");
document.write(x.hasAttributeNS(ns,"lang"));

Output:

Attribute Found: true
Attribute Found: false
